Instructions

  1. Craft the pastry by blending flour and salt in a mixing bowl, incorporating cold butter until it resembles grainy texture. Introduce ice water gradually, kneading until dough forms cohesively. Shape into a compact disc, encase in plastic wrap, and chill for 30 minutes in the refrigerator.
  2. Heat oven to 375F (190C) with rack positioned in center position.
  3. Arrange tomato slices on paper towel-lined tray, sprinkle with salt, allowing moisture to drain for 15 minutes.
  4. Dust work surface with flour, gently roll pastry into circular shape matching 9-inch pie dish dimensions. Carefully transfer dough, trim edges, and perforate bottom using fork.
  5. Pre-bake crust for 10-12 minutes until achieving delicate golden hue.
  6. Combine mozzarella, Parmesan, ricotta, minced garlic, oregano, and basil in separate container. Distribute cheese blend evenly across pre-baked crust.
  7. Thoroughly blot tomato slices with fresh paper towels, artfully layer atop cheese mixture. Drizzle olive oil across surface.
  8. Roast pie for 25-30 minutes until cheese melts dramatically and tomatoes caramelize slightly.
  9. Finish by scattering fresh basil leaves across surface before presenting.

Notes

  • Drain tomatoes thoroughly to prevent a soggy crust, using paper towels and salt to draw out excess moisture before layering.
  • Experiment with cheese varieties like fontina or gouda for unique flavor profiles while maintaining the classic Italian essence.
  • Make the pie gluten-free by substituting regular flour with almond or gluten-free blend, ensuring the crust remains crispy and flavorful.
  • Prep ingredients ahead of time and chill the dough overnight to develop deeper, more complex flavors in the crust and enhance overall texture.
